[QUOTE="Dragonwriter, post: 5431393, member: 54988"] EDIT: Closed again. But just in case, I'm willing to accept notes of interest and/or alternates. :) Adventure Name: Jaws of the Demon Wastes Level(s): 4th to start, ending level unknown Date/Time: Saturdays 7 P.M. PST on the OpenRPG Dev II server Expected Duration of this session: 2-3 hours each week Format: Campaign Adventure Plug: (What someone might have heard about the adventure before it started, or what the adventure involves.) The Demon Wastes… A place feared and reviled by just about everyone with any common sense. But it is seen by others, those less concerned with their own personal safety, as a possible source of wealth. After all, those ancient ruins still hide secrets. And don’t forget the minerals, gems and Khyber dragonshards. You are one of these enterprising folks, along with the rest of your adventuring/exploring allies. You set out to this place, starting with the little House Tharashk hamlet of Blood Crescent, to make your fortune. How you go about that goal is up to you. But know the land is rough and cruel and you will have to wrest your sought-after wealth from the Jaws of the Demon Wastes! ------ I am seeking a few more additions to a new Saturday evening Eberron game. I already have a few players and need to fill out the roster (though the game hasn’t begun yet). I am hoping to have the campaign begin on the 22nd of January. Rules: Characters start at 4th level with minimum XP (6,000) and standard wealth (5,400 GP). 32 point-buy, max HP/level. No Evil characters. Access to Core + Eberron Campaign Setting book + 2 books of your choice from the sblock’ed list below. [s]Also, I would like one Roleplaying “Quirk” for your character. Something unique/unusual that others will notice after working with you for a while. We are also working with a small shared history (still being worked out) for the group.[/s] This game will include non-Core elements (beyond the ECS). However, these elements will be limited by a few things. 1: Only material from books in my collection will be allowed. No exceptions. 2: You get to choose 2 (and only 2) books to draw material from. [sblock=Available Books] Choose any 2. These books are largely OK, just double-check things first. Not much to worry about. Player's Handbook 2 Complete Arcane Complete Warrior Planar Handbook Stormwrack Races of the Dragon Dragon Magic Magic of Incarnum Tome of Magic Tome of Battle: Book of Nine Swords These ones have less player-oriented material, and some may not be suitable for this game. Definitely check with me before using specific material. Libris Mortis: Book of the Undead Draconomicon: Book of Dragons Fiendish Codex 1: Hordes of the Abyss Fiendish Codex 2: Tyrants of the Nine Hells [/sblock] The players I currently have signed on for the game are setting up a Beguiler, a Fighter, a Halfling Druid or Ranger, and the last player is trying to decide between Barbarian and Bard (or multiclassing between the two). I am attempting to make this somewhat sandbox-style. As such, there are a few things to keep in mind. 1: As this will be more sandbox, missions/quests will only come to you if you seek them out. This is intended to be a player-driven game. 2: Not everything will be able to be killed when you encounter it. There will be times when your best option is “RUN!” 3: In a similar vein, not everything you encounter in the Wastes will be out to kill you. Eberron has looser alignment and just because something may be Evil does not mean it is out to harm everyone it meets. Some traditionally “Evil” creatures wouldn’t mind sitting down to afternoon tea and having a friendly chat, no violence or subterfuge involved. Thanks for reading this post. If you have any questions, feel free to ask. (And a small note: This topic is cross-posted on OpenRPG's recruiting forum. Act fast!) [sblock=Short OpenRPG description] And for those unfamiliar with OpenRPG, it is a free virtual table-top program with chat, maps, dice rollers, etc. You can download it [url=http://www.rpgobjects.com/index.php?c=orpg]here[/url].[/sblock] [/QUOTE]
